Wondering How To Make Your HANDMADE RUGS Rock? Read This!

Use high-quality materials: The quality of the materials you use will have a big impact on the final product. Choose high-quality yarns or fabrics that are durable and long-lasting.

Experiment with colors and patterns: Don’t be afraid to try new color combinations or patterns. Mix and match different patterns and colors to create unique and eye-catching designs.

Add texture: Texture can add depth and interest to your rug. Try using different weaving techniques, adding fringe or tassels, or incorporating different materials to create texture.

Consider the shape and size: Rugs don’t have to be rectangular or square. Consider creating a circular or oval rug, or experiment with different sizes to fit the space you’re decorating.

Personalize it: Add a personal touch to your rug by incorporating your initials, a meaningful phrase, or a special design element that reflects your personality or style.

Care for your rug: Proper care and maintenance will help your rug last longer and look its best. Be sure to vacuum regularly, spot-clean any spills or stains, and rotate your rug to prevent uneven wear.
